Volume Adjustment Slewing
Volume changes are smoothed by stepping through intermediate steps. VSEN
also ensures that the volume automatically ramps from the minimum setting to
the programmed value at turn-on and back to the minimum value at turn-off.
0 = Enabled.
1 = Disabled.
Zero-Crossing Detection
ZDEN holds volume changes until there is a zero-crossing in the audio signal.
This reduces clicks during volume changes (zipper noise). If no zero-crossing
is detected within 100ms, the volume change is forced.
0 = Enabled.
1 = Disabled.
Jack Insertion Polling Speed
A fast polling speed tests for a jack insertion 3 times per second, while a
slow polling speed tests for jack insertion every 2 seconds. Setting the polling
speed to slow mode saves shutdown power consumption while the mechanical
JACKSW switch is operational.
0 = Slow polling mode, 2s delay between polls.
1 = Fast polling mode, 333ms delay between polls.
Class H Threshold Select
THRH selects the threshold at which the power supplies switch from Q0.9V
to Q1.8V. A higher threshold allows the IC’s output stage to be powered from
Q0.9V for a higher percentage of the audio waveform, decreasing power dis-
sipation at the expense of dynamic distortion.
0 = Low threshold.
1 = High threshold.
Automatic Mode Select
Set AUTO to allow the IC to enable functional blocks depending on the load.
In auto mode, the user merely reads the status of registers 0x1D and 0x1E to
find out what blocks are enabled. Setting AUTO makes bits register 0x1D and
0x01E read-only (except SHDN and SLEEP). Clear AUTO to give the system
control of what functional blocks are active. The user needs to allow the jack
configuration detect algorithm to complete before enabling functional blocks.
00 = User controls which functional blocks are on. Registers 0x1D and 0x1E
are R/W.
01 = The IC enables functional blocks automatically depending on the results
of the jack configuration detect algorithm after SHDN is set.
10 = The IC enables functional blocks automatically depending on the results
of the jack configuration detect algorithm regardless of whether SHDN is set.
SHDN must go to high to enable audio playback.
